Senior Full-Stack Developer

CapIntel
Summary
Join CapIntel, a rapidly growing wealthtech company, as a Senior Full-Stack Developer to contribute to the architecture, scalability, and performance of our innovative financial platform. You will collaborate with designers, product managers, and other developers to build high-quality, scalable solutions. Responsibilities include architecting and building web applications using JavaScript/TypeScript, React, Express.js, and Node.js, optimizing performance and infrastructure, ensuring accessibility and UI consistency, and integrating seamlessly across the stack. You will also conduct code reviews, implement testing strategies, collaborate cross-functionally, and continuously evaluate and adopt emerging technologies. The ideal candidate possesses full-stack expertise, MERN stack proficiency, a deep understanding of backend architecture, and strong testing and communication skills. CapIntel offers a collaborative environment and the opportunity to work on impactful products.
Requirements
- Full-Stack Expertise: Significant experience with JavaScript/TypeScript, including React and Node.js
- MERN Stack Experience: Proficient with MongoDB, Express.js, React, and Node.js
- Backend Architecture: Deep understanding of scalable backend design, API development, and system integrations
- Testing & Quality: You build with quality in mind, writing maintainable code supported by thorough testing practices
- Clear Communication: You communicate technical decisions effectively with both technical and non-technical stakeholders
- Ownership and Flexibility: You take initiative, follow through on responsibilities, and adapt as priorities evolve
Responsibilities
- Architect and build scalable web applications using JavaScript/TypeScript, React, Express.js, and Node.js
- Optimize performance and infrastructure , including caching strategies, lazy loading, and efficient database queries
- Ensure accessibility and UI consistency (WCAG compliance) across our platform
- Integrate seamlessly across the stack , ensuring smooth communication between frontend and backend systems
- Conduct thoughtful code reviews and contribute to a high standard of technical quality
- Implement testing strategies , using tools like Jest to ensure reliability and stability
- Collaborate cross-functionally to align engineering efforts with product and business goals
- Continuously evaluate and adopt emerging technologies that improve developer workflows and platform scalability
Preferred Qualifications
- Experience with cloud platforms (AWS, GCP), CI/CD pipelines, and DevOps best practices
- Experience with serverless architectures (e.g., AWS Lambda)
- Expertise in identifying and solving complex system performance issues
Share this job:
Similar Remote Jobs
